Manchester United ended their post-season tour with a 3-1 win against Hong Kong XI.
Casemiro had an early goal ruled out before Shea Lacey missed a great chance to put [United](https://www.manchestereveningnews.co.uk/all-about/manchester-united-fc) ahead, but it was the hosts who took the lead as Juninho’s shot squirmed under Tom Heaton.
[Chido Obi](https://www.manchestereveningnews.co.uk/all-about/chido-obi-martin) came on at half-time and he made it 1-1 just five minutes into the second half with a smart left-footed finish.
Obi squandered a chance to put United ahead as he put a free header wide but he made up for his miss with an excellent glancing header with 10 minutes to play. Ayden Heaven scored late on to make it 3-1.
